  • Abstract
    In a world focused on the need of selling an increasingly large quantity of goods, quality, visual appearance, texture, flavor, taste etc. become central elements that support the global economic development. As a result, different types of food additives were and are still designed and used to fulfill such objectives. In what follows, the aim of this paper is to present the design and implementation of a new software package for embedded systems (smart phones) able to support a customer in the process of food purchasing. The developed software package runs on an Android platform and uses a cloud optical character recognition (OCR) algorithm. The information related to the product of interest and supplied at request to the customers are: the name and the code of the product´s additives, the risks associated with each food additive, the source of each food components, the limit of its daily consumption and the side effects, diet restrictions etc.
